**Ticket #977 — Parity vault locked (Lumabind SDKs)**

Welcome aboard. The comparison vault tracking feature parity between the Lumabind Swift and Kotlin SDKs is currently locked after an expired seal token. You'll need it open to update the parity matrix before the sync review on Thursday. Follow the unseal steps in the onboarding doc exactly, then enter the recovery passphrase shown below.

recovery phrase for fawif-tajeg: norael-aldmir-casir-brivan-ulaion

Plugin authors targeting the Querrel planner should rerun their conformance suites against build 4.2-rc1, which reintroduces the join-reordering regression first seen in the Marloft release. Capture plan digests before and after each run so we can diff operator trees. The staging harness at the Fenwick cluster requires authenticated calls, using the token shown below.

portal login ticket: eyJhbGciOiJIUzI1NiIsInR5cCI6IkpXVCJ9.eyJzdWIiOiI0Z4ywpUMsBIn0.ca5FVhkdBXa3

CI keeps failing on the Murwell Gallery audio-guide app at the asset-bundling stage. Cause: the tour-narration packer expects lowercase locale codes; someone committed "FR-ca" manifests. Fix locally by running the normalizer script in tools/ before pushing. Don't retrigger the pipeline more than twice — the Soundpath runner queue backs up fast and the whole Ostermill team gets blocked. If it still fails after normalization, escalate in the build channel and quote the token appended below.

pipeline stamp: htk4_ae36

Team,

The gross-margin review for the Quillon product line is complete. Margin slipped 2.1 points, driven mainly by higher component costs at the Fenwick Ridge facility and unplanned freight surcharges. Cost-recovery measures identified by Tomas Eldray should restore roughly half the gap by year end. Finance should fold these assumptions into the next forecast cycle and flag any discrepancies before Friday. Full workings are in the shared ledger. The confidential note on related business plans follows directly below.

Regards,
Corinne

internal memo for hafog-hadug: The pricing group signed off on a budget of $16.1 million for Project Gorir. The renewal with Oliionax Systems closes at $14.1 million a year, 46 percent above the last contract.